Output 3e8668d361c9e89db04bd3a5717842eff353f59d0eccddf63b7a20e6cf9c3810:2

value
1589906095
script pubkey
OP_0 OP_PUSHBYTES_32 4521ba7d8ee82b04c4fbf5a56738b742621cdcff9a51e294acfedb5c486fab47
address
bc1qg5sm5lvwaq4sf38m7kjkww9hgf3peh8lnfg7999vlmd4cjr04drsnxz96q
transaction
3e8668d361c9e89db04bd3a5717842eff353f59d0eccddf63b7a20e6cf9c3810
spent
true